Broken or Damaged Hinges

Over time, upv door hinges can be damaged and stiff due to the constant strain. Drops or bumps that happen accidentally can also cause damage. It is crucial to address these issues as soon as you can, to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

There are several methods to repair broken or damaged hinges, depending on the kind of hinge. If you have a screw-in style hinge, you could try using bondo or wood putty and filling the hole. This is temporary solution that will wear away with time. You can also buy a cabinet hinge plate which will cover the damaged area. It has new holes to screw into.

Another alternative is to make use of an epoxy and a dowel. This is a longer-lasting solution, but it will require some technical know-how. You will require dowels of the same diameter. The dowels need to be cut to the proper size, and then glued using epoxy. Be sure to push the dowels in until they're flush with the surface of the wood to ensure that your screws will have a solid grip when you attach the hinges.

Lintels damaged

Lintels are essential for the strength and structural integrity of your building. They help to balance the brick walls that protect windows, doors, and other openings. They are constructed of different materials, but they are susceptible to damage because of damp and aging. This can cause them fail and put the structure in danger. To avoid the expense of replacement of lintels, it is vital that you have your lintels repaired as soon as they become damaged.

Typically, the most prominent sign of a lintel problem is visible cracks above doors and windows. These cracks typically appear as stepped vertical cracks that are diagonally extending from the edge of an opening. This type of cracking is a clear indication that the lintel's frame is no longer able to support the wall it is above.

If you are unsure whether your lintel is damaged, you should seek the services of a professional structural engineer to evaluate your building. They will be able to give you guidance on the best method to repair your lintel.

Concrete lintels may be reinforced with steel rods to improve their strength and durability. However, these steel rods may corrode over time and begin to expand which will cause the concrete that is above them to crack. A repair for a lintel near me should include replacement of this steel and an application of waterproofing to avoid any future problems.

The lintels of timber are also susceptible to dampness, which could cause wood rot and the need for repairs to lintels. In this case it might be necessary to replace the current lintel by a new one made from helical bars. These reinforcement bars are bound with anchor grout, forming an extremely strong beam for masonry. These reinforcement bars are a great alternative to traditional timber lintels. They can also be used to strengthen brick or masonry Lintels.
